Wireless Analytics, which develops enterprise mobility management solutions, has just announced that it is releasing version 4 of its Communications Lifecycle Expense Analytics (CLEAN) platform this fall.
The CLEAN Platform is a cloud-based subscription application with high-touch support that enables enterprises to gain complete visibility into mobile spend and usage across all major carriers. The CLEAN Platform can allocate every penny of the enterprise's mobile invoices down to the line level, providing a high degree of mobility insight.
Version 4 of the CLEAN platform adds a tablet-friendly interface, flexible integration intranets, enhanced visibility into corporate mobility data at multiple levels of the organization, localization support, an easy to use custom reporting interface, and tighter integration with third-party systems through a REST-based API, according to the company.

The CLEAN platform serves as another tool in the toolbox of enterprises that understand the value from monitoring and controlling telecom spend through telecom expense management.
Most enterprises overpay when it comes to telecom costs, largely due to opaque telecom billing and too many moving parts in the typical enterprise telecom bill. With telecom expense management software, businesses can reassert authority over these bills and ensure that pricing is both accurate and that nothing is being purchased that is not needed.
